{"product_id":"ir-obstacle-avoidance-sensor-module-lm393-photoelectric-sensor","title":"IR Obstacle Avoidance Sensor Module LM393 Photoelectric Sensor","description":"\u003ch1\u003eIR Obstacle Avoidance Sensor Module - LM393 Photoelectric Sensor Module\u003c\/h1\u003e\n\u003cp\u003eThis module pairs an infrared emitter with a photoelectric receiver to detect objects directly in its path. The onboard LM393 comparator converts the reflected signal into a clean digital output. Use it for collision detection, proximity switching, or edge following on any microcontroller board.\u003c\/p\u003e\n\n\u003ch2\u003eKey Specifications\u003c\/h2\u003e\n\u003ctable\u003e\n  \u003cthead\u003e\u003ctr\u003e\n\u003cth\u003eSpecification\u003c\/th\u003e\n\u003cth\u003eValue\u003c\/th\u003e\n\u003c\/tr\u003e\u003c\/thead\u003e\n  \u003ctbody\u003e\n    \u003ctr\u003e\n\u003ctd\u003eOperating Voltage\u003c\/td\u003e\n\u003ctd\u003e3.3V to 5V DC\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eComparator IC\u003c\/td\u003e\n\u003ctd\u003eLM393\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eDetection Distance\u003c\/td\u003e\n\u003ctd\u003e2cm to 30cm (adjustable via potentiometer)\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eDetection Angle\u003c\/td\u003e\n\u003ctd\u003e35°\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eOutput Type\u003c\/td\u003e\n\u003ctd\u003eDigital (High\/Low) active LOW when obstacle detected\u003c\/td\u003e\n\u003c\/tr\u003e\n    \u003ctr\u003e\n\u003ctd\u003eBoard Dimensions\u003c\/td\u003e\n\u003ctd\u003e45mm × 15mm × 10mm\u003c\/td\u003e\n\u003c\/tr\u003e\n  \u003c\/tbody\u003e\n\u003c\/table\u003e\n\n\u003ch2\u003eWhat You Can Build With This\u003c\/h2\u003e\n\u003cul\u003e\n  \u003cli\u003e\u003ca href=\"\/products\/kit-obstacle-avoiding-robot\"\u003eObstacle-avoiding wheeled robot using two sensors for left\/right detection\u003c\/a\u003e\u003c\/li\u003e\n  \u003cli\u003eContactless object counter on a conveyor belt or doorway\u003c\/li\u003e\n  \u003cli\u003eProximity alarm that triggers when someone approaches a restricted area\u003c\/li\u003e\n  \u003cli\u003e\u003ca href=\"\/products\/kit-smart-dustbin-lid\"\u003eSmart dustbin lid that opens automatically when a hand is detected\u003c\/a\u003e\u003c\/li\u003e\n\u003c\/ul\u003e\n\n\u003ch2\u003eCompatibility\u003c\/h2\u003e\n\u003cp\u003eWorks with any development board that reads a digital input: Arduino Uno, Mega, Nano, ESP8266, ESP32, Raspberry Pi (with logic level shifting), STM32, and similar. Output signal drives a 5V or 3.3V logic pin directly; an onboard LED gives visual indication of detection.\u003c\/p\u003e\n\n\u003ch2\u003eWiring Notes\u003c\/h2\u003e\n\u003cp\u003eConnect VCC to 5V (or 3.3V for low-voltage boards), GND to common ground, and OUT to any digital I\/O pin. The potentiometer adjusts sensitivity — turn clockwise for longer range. Keep the emitter and receiver unobstructed; dust or glare can affect readings. Sinking current on OUT is limited to 20mA, so do not drive a relay or motor directly.\u003c\/p\u003e\n\n\u003ch2\u003eWhy Buy from Compoden\u003c\/h2\u003e\n\u003cp\u003eEvery component is sourced from verified suppliers and tested for compatibility before listing. If defective on arrival, replace within 7 days.\u003c\/p\u003e\n\n\u003cdetails\u003e\u003csummary\u003eIs this compatible with Arduino Uno?\u003c\/summary\u003e\u003cp\u003eYes, connect VCC to 5V, GND to GND, and OUT to a digital pin such as D2. Read the pin as INPUT, and you will see LOW when an obstacle is detected.\u003c\/p\u003e\u003c\/details\u003e\n\u003cdetails\u003e\u003csummary\u003eCan the detection range exceed 30cm?\u003c\/summary\u003e\u003cp\u003eUnder ideal conditions (dark, non-reflective background) it can sometimes reach 40cm, but reliable detection is within 2-30cm. The range also depends on the color and surface of the object.\u003c\/p\u003e\u003c\/details\u003e\n\u003cdetails\u003e\u003csummary\u003eWhat does the output pin show when no obstacle is present?\u003c\/summary\u003e\u003cp\u003eThe OUT pin stays HIGH (near VCC) when no reflection is received. It drops LOW when the sensor detects a reflected IR signal above the threshold set by the potentiometer.\u003c\/p\u003e\u003c\/details\u003e\n\u003cdiv class=\"compoden-handoff\" style=\"margin-top:24px;padding:16px;background:#f0f4ff;border-left:4px solid #2B4D8F;border-radius:4px;\"\u003e\n  \u003cp style=\"margin:0 0 6px 0;font-weight:600;color:#1A3560;\"\u003e📦 Free Setup Handoff Document Included\u003c\/p\u003e\n  \u003cp style=\"margin:0;font-size:0.95em;color:#333;\"\u003eEvery Compoden order includes a free setup handoff document — step-by-step instructions to get your component working within minutes.
